개발후라이
개발후라이
개발후라이
  • 분류 전체보기 (287)
    • Web Front End (76)
      • Javascript & Typescript (26)
      • React (12)
      • Vue (4)
      • Nodejs (1)
      • HTML (6)
      • CSS (8)
      • HTTP (6)
      • 책 - Review (8)
    • TIL (0)
    • Problem Solved (135)
      • 알고리즘 (4)
      • BOJ (67)
      • Programmers (8)
      • HackerRank (33)
      • LeetCode (23)
    • 회고 (4)
      • 오늘의 회고 (16)
      • 주간 회고 (15)
      • 월간 회고 (7)
      • WakaTime (9)
    • Git (3)
    • 기타 (15)
      • 취업 (5)
      • 자격증 (1)

블로그 메뉴

  • GitHub
  • LinkedIn
  • 홈

인기 글

태그

  • 노개북
  • TypeScript
  • JavaScript
  • 노마드북클럽
  • 개발자
  • 프론트엔드
  • 릿코드
  • 오늘의회고
  • 자바스크립트
  • 회고

최근 댓글

최근 글

전체 방문자
오늘
어제

티스토리

hELLO · Designed By 정상우.
개발후라이
Problem Solved/HackerRank

[HackerRank] Day 8: Dictionaries and Maps

Problem Solved/HackerRank

[HackerRank] Day 8: Dictionaries and Maps

2019. 11. 7. 00:41
반응형

문제

https://www.hackerrank.com/challenges/30-dictionaries-and-maps/problem?h_r=next-challenge&h_v=zen&h_r=next-challenge&h_v=zen&h_r=next-challenge&h_v=zen&h_r=next-challenge&h_v=zen

 

Day 8: Dictionaries and Maps | HackerRank

Mapping Keys to Values using a Map or Dictionary.

www.hackerrank.com

문제 설명

맵을 이용해 푸는 문제

1
2
//맵 선언 방법
Map<String, Integer> phoneBook = new HashMap<String, Integer>();
cs

 

성공 코드

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
class Solution{
    public static void main(String []argh){
        Scanner in = new Scanner(System.in);
        int n = in.nextInt();
        Map<String, Integer> phoneBook = new HashMap<String, Integer>();
 
        for(int i = 0; i < n; i++){
            String name = in.next();
            int phone = in.nextInt();
            // Map에 저장
            phoneBook.put(name, phone);
        }
        while(in.hasNext()){
            String s = in.next();
            // 전화부에 s가 있으면 번호 출력, 아니면 not found
            if (phoneBook.containsKey(s))
                System.out.println(s + "=" + phoneBook.get(s));
            else
                System.out.println("Not found");
        }
        in.close();
    }
}
Colored by Color Scripter
cs
반응형
    'Problem Solved/HackerRank' 카테고리의 다른 글
    • [HackerRank] Day 9: Recursion 3(재귀3)
    • [HackerRank] [MySQL] Revising Aggregations - The Count Function
    • [HackerRank] Day 7: Arrays
    • [HackerRank] Day 6: Let's Review
    개발후라이
    개발후라이
    어제보다 오늘 발전하기 위한 공간 https://github.com/choisohyun

    티스토리툴바

    단축키

    내 블로그

    내 블로그 - 관리자 홈 전환
    Q
    Q
    새 글 쓰기
    W
    W

    블로그 게시글

    글 수정 (권한 있는 경우)
    E
    E
    댓글 영역으로 이동
    C
    C

    모든 영역

    이 페이지의 URL 복사
    S
    S
    맨 위로 이동
    T
    T
    티스토리 홈 이동
    H
    H
    단축키 안내
    Shift + /
    ⇧ + /

    * 단축키는 한글/영문 대소문자로 이용 가능하며, 티스토리 기본 도메인에서만 동작합니다.